CHOOSING WHAT IS – A Morning Poem

(–written March 19, 2020, during the corona virus “home-sheltering” mandate.)

With all the “have-to’s” stripped away,
My deeper “wants” come into play.
Yet, ‘midst the swirl within my mind,
My true desires are tough to find.

“I should” still rears its tyrant’s head,
Replacing wants with “but, instead
I should” do this, accomplish that,
The list grows long, in seconds flat.

I wonder, will there come a time
When peace prevails within my mind?
When what I’m doing here and now
Just feels like enough, somehow?

Perhaps that time can be today
Perhaps right here, right now, I’ll say
“The only time there is, is NOW.”
And knowing this, I will allow

This thought, this choice, this thing at hand
To be enough, to understand
That although chaos ‘round me reigns,
I can choose peace within my brain

By simply letting what is, be.
And choosing what’s in front of me:
To wash a dish, or pull a weed,
Or tend to someone else’s need.

To sit and stare off into space
Or draw within and find that place
Where I can hold the world’s vast wrongs
Within the Love that keeps me strong.

So, just for now, I gently calm
The chaos with a deeper balm –
The balm of Love, compassion, grace…

I’m ready now, this day to face.
